Alexander Viktorovich Kutikov is a Russian rock musician, composer, and producer born on 13 April 1952 in Moscow. He achieved professional recognition as the bass guitarist and vocalist for the ensemble Mashina Vremeni, which he joined in 1971. Between 1974 and 1979, he performed with the group Leap Summer before rejoining Mashina Vremeni. He composed the music and performed vocals for the track “Povorot” (1979). The ensemble achieved professional recognition for the soundtrack to the film Dusha (1981). In 1987, Kutikov established the sound recording company Sintez Records. His recording career includes the solo studio recordings Tantsy na kryshe (1990) and Demony lyubvi (2009). He received the Order of Honour (1999) and the title of Merited Artist of the Russian Federation (1999). His discography includes the compilation The Best. Mashina vremeni (2002) and the solo studio recording Beskonechnomgnovenno (2016).
